Tracxn Technologies operates a global private market data and software platform serving venture capital, private equity, investment banks, and corporate M&A teams across over 50 countries. The company monetizes this data through subscriptions, currently generating roughly 21 crore in quarterly revenue with a customer base of 2,350 accounts and 6,534 users as of Q1 FY27. The niche is highly concentrated with only 5 to 6 global players, where Tracxn holds a top three position and dominates the Indian market. Despite a 90% gross margin, the business reported negative 4.2 crore EBITDA in Q1 FY27 due to aggressive growth investments and non-cash ESOP charges. This margin profile reveals a high-quality data business where the cost structure is almost entirely fixed in human capital, meaning incremental revenue holds the key to profitability.
The durability of this business stems from a deep data moat that is difficult to replicate. Tracxn has expanded its legal entity coverage to 66 million entities across major countries and its private company financials coverage in India by 10x over the last year, now wider than any other platform globally. This data is highly unstructured and behind paywalls across 20 plus countries, making it difficult for generic large language models to replicate without specialized infrastructure. Furthermore, the company has used AI to multiply key data point coverage by 4x in 2025 while reducing data production headcount by 20%, lowering its cost of data production. With sales cycles of just 1.5 to 2 months and demo to closure conversions of 15 to 20 percent, the platform demonstrates strong product market fit and switching costs once embedded into client processes.
The inflection point centers on scaling the sales force and launching new datasets to re-accelerate growth from a flat 21 crore quarterly revenue base. Management is doubling the closing sales team from 34 at the end of December 2025 to 60 by the end of December 2026, with the international team scaling from less than 10 to 25. By 18 to 24 months out, the business is expected to look fundamentally different as the India vertical team playbook is replicated to the US and UK. New revenue and valuation datasets for the US and Europe are launching in FY27, alongside AI-native access via a Claude connector and AI chat assistant expected to contribute revenue from FY27. This mix shift and sales scaling is targeted to push overall growth above 20 percent, with India targeted at 15 to 20 percent growth for FY27.
Management has consistently promised to scale sales and data coverage, and the latest calls show steady execution on this front. Customer accounts have grown 16 percent YoY to 2,350 in Q1 FY27, with 61 net new accounts added in the quarter, validating the sales scaling thesis. However, the walk-talk on profitability shows tension: management promised non-linear EBITDA expansion with up to 80 percent incremental revenue conversion, yet Q1 FY27 EBITDA was negative 4.2 crore and free cash flow was negative 2.2 crore. This is a structural consequence of investing ahead of revenue, as total expenses are guided to increase 10 percent for the year while the sales team scales. The balance sheet remains solid with 90.2 crore in cash at the end of Q3 FY26, and management intends to execute another share buyback once eligible, indicating no dilution risk.
The quantified earnings path requires overall revenue growth to re-accelerate above 20 percent and international growth to rebound from Q1 FY27 onwards, which management has explicitly guided. For this to hold, the 60 person closing sales team must be fully operational by end of 2026 and the new US and Europe datasets must successfully improve win rates. The single most important falsifier is the international segment, which saw revenue decline 5 crore YoY in FY26 due to a 10-year low in private market deal volume. If the US sales team scaling from less than 10 to 25 people fails to replicate the India playbook within 3 to 4 quarters, the operating leverage thesis breaks, and the high fixed cost base of employee expenses at 88 percent of total expenses will continue to suppress EBITDA.
companyname: Tracxn Technologies Limited ticker: TRACXN sector: Private Market Data & Intelligence (SaaS) Tracxn builds and sells a subscription data platform for the global private markets. The product answers a simple question: if public market investors have Bloomberg, what do investors in private companies use?
